Essential Hood Seal for Optimal Performance

The hood weatherstrip is a crucial component for every vehicle, acting as a protective barrier against the elements. Positioned strategically around the hood's perimeter, this seal prevents water, dust, and debris from entering the engine bay. It plays a pivotal role in safeguarding the engine's integrity by minimizing exposure to harmful contaminants, which could lead to potential damage or decreased efficiency. A properly functioning weatherstrip keeps your engine running smoothly by maintaining optimal temperature and ensuring all components are shielded from external exposure.

Functionality of the Weatherstrip

This seal is crafted from durable, flexible rubber, designed to fit snugly around the hood's edge. It not only keeps external elements at bay but also aids in noise reduction, making for a quieter ride by absorbing vibrations and sealing out wind noise. Its elastic nature allows it to adjust with temperature fluctuations, ensuring a consistent protective barrier in varying climates. The weatherstrip acts as a silent guardian, preserving the lifespan and functionality of your car's engine and other critical components.

Consequences of a Damaged Weatherstrip

When this part becomes worn or damaged, it can lead to several issues. A compromised seal may result in water leaks, potentially causing electrical short circuits or corrosion to engine components. Dust and debris infiltration can lead to blockages or abrasion, affecting engine performance and efficiency. Additionally, increased noise and vibrations can disrupt a comfortable driving experience. Replacing a faulty weatherstrip is imperative to ensure vehicle longevity and to prevent costly repairs down the line.
